Primary Duties Performs complex clerical accounting such as posting and reconciling ledgers, bank accounts, preparing trial balances and statistical reports, resolving cash accounting discrepancies. Leads others in accounting clerical activities of a unit, provides guidance and instruction, assists in determining work priorities. Compiles and/or coordinates collection of data for inclusion in a variety of regular reports following prescribed format. Reviews and/or processes financial documents such as invoices, vouchers, receipts, requisitions and reports, ensuring accuracy of mathematical computations and completeness; resolves discrepancies. Monitors departmental accounts by gathering statistical data, maintaining reports and records, identifying variances, errors and discrepancies. Performs analysis of sales transactions and bank account deposits by reviewing entries, verifying amounts, compiling and comparing balances. Maintains manual and automated recordkeeping systems by tracking, verifying and updating records, files and reports. Inputs, monitors, and corrects data in automated systems; generates reports.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ities General knowledge of bookkeeping principles, mathematical methods and techniques and accounting standards. Skill in performing mathematical computations; in reviewing and processing financial documents; in reconciling financial data; in operating calculators, keyboards, manual and automated office equipment, personal computers and financial software; in inputing data. Ability to communicate effectively; to prepare written records and reports; to establish and maintain effective work relationships; to lead and train others in assigned accounting clerical or bookkeeping work.
